Banana Split Ice Cream Pie



Today is National Chocolate Ice Cream Day! To celebrate, I thought I would show you an ice cream pie that I have made a few times and that my family loves. You can change the flavors of ice cream that you use, depending on what you like, but since it is Chocolate Ice Cream Day I used chocolate :)

Get a graham cracker or chocolate cookie crust.


Layer 1/2 of the carton of ice cream in the bottom.


Add a liberal layer of sliced bananas.


Now chocolate syrup.


The other 1/2 of the ice cream.


Arrange some strawberries so that they look nice to you. Add some more chocolate syrup and whipped cream. You could also add nuts here if you'd like.


Freeze if for at least 2 hours. When you are ready to slice it, let it sit out for about 30 minutes to make life easier on yourself. Your pie won't get all melty because you won't be fending off little fingers, taking pictures and pleading with your children to PLEASE. STOP. FIGHTING.

You could use any fruits, ice creams and toppings that you wanted and have a whole different pie each time. Or you could blend the fruits with the ice cream (kind of like a milkshake) and have your layers be different flavors. I'm just too lazy to clean the blender, so I do it like this :)
